Following last Thursday's incident where the Stagelight seat-map renderer froze during the Orpheline Hall on-sale, we committed to capping concurrent render workers and introducing progressive tile loading. Marisol Dane owns the fix, targeted for next sprint. The root cause was unbounded SVG regeneration on every hold event, which saturated the render pool. We agreed to make all pool and debounce settings explicit config rather than hardcoded values, recorded below for review at the sync.

tuning table, yajog-yahof:
BUDGETS = {
    "lamvan": 303,
    "wenox": 460,
    "fenvan": 525,
}

Subject: FY Headcount Plan — First Pass

Hi folks,

Department heads, thanks for getting your asks in early. Quick summary: we can fund roughly 60% of requested roles, with priority going to the Quillbrook platform team and field service in the Esterly region. Backfills are mostly safe; net-new roles will need a business case by month-end. We'll hash out the trade-offs at Tuesday's session. One piece stays within this group for now, and it's summarized just below this message.

board note of bawep-tajef: Queniusek Systems plans to raise the Quenvan list price by 53.1 percent in March. The pricing group signed off on a budget of $176.4 million for Project Drueth. The renewal with Casionix Partners closes at $142.5 million a year, 8.3 percent below the last contract. Project Fraax slips by six weeks because of the tooling delay.

TURN-208: Gatevale turnstile counters at the Merrow Field pilot double-count when a rotation reverses mid-cycle. Attendance totals drift roughly 2% high per event. The debounce window fix is implemented, reviewed by Ilsa, and soak-tested across two simulated match days without drift. Ready for your cut; the candidate build is identified below.

trace token, tagag-tafog: htk6_5ed18c

CI note for support: if a customer reports "ghost orders" reappearing after deletion in Basketly, it's probably the integration suite — our CI fixtures reset the soft-delete flag on the orders table between runs, and a flaky teardown can leak that into staging demos. Not a data-loss bug. When you escalate, include the trace token shown just below.

session token of tajef-bageg = htk21_5d90d574934f3ccae6437